Designing extensions to work efficiently and as cost effective as possible, can be a complicated affair. Various factors have to be taken into account, from an early stage, in relation to the existing dwelling and it is quiet often the case that you do not know these constraints, until the existing property has been surveyed and the proposed extension designed.

Project: Fairoak cottage, Ashford hill

This house dates back to approximately 1920 and was recently purchased to be transformed into a traditional family home. The property was already a substantial sized house but had been left for many years and required everything from new heating through to new electrics and even replacement of parts of the original roof.

Our client gave us a brief to substantially extend the property and enhance the look of the elevations. A large extension to the rear of the house has been designed incorporating an impressive upstairs master bedroom and large open plan kitchen/dining area.
